Abstract

Methods and apparatus for summarizing a chatbot interaction with a user are provided. The method comprises using at least one computer hardware processor to perform generating an initial summary based, at least in part, on user data, receiving first input from the user during the chatbot interaction, processing the first input with a natural language processing engine, updating the initial summary based, at least in part, on an output of the processing by the natural language processing engine to generate an updated summary, wherein the updating is performed prior to completion of the chatbot interaction, and outputting a final summary of the chatbot interaction, wherein the final summary of the chatbot interaction is based, at least in part, on the updated summary.

Claims (61)

1. A method of summarizing a chatbot interaction with a first user, the method comprising:

using at least one computer hardware processor to perform:

receiving user data of the first user via a network from at least one application executing on at least one computer;

generating an initial summary based, at least in part, on the received user data of the first user;

receiving first input from the first user during the chatbot interaction;

processing the first input with a natural language processing engine;

updating the initial summary based, at least in part, on an output of the processing by the natural language processing engine to generate an updated summary, wherein the updating is performed prior to completion of the chatbot interaction; and

outputting a final summary of the chatbot interaction, wherein the final summary of the chatbot interaction is based, at least in part, on the updated summary,

wherein outputting the final summary of the chatbot interaction comprises providing the final summary of the chatbot interaction to the at least one application executing on the at least one computer, the at least one application enabling, at least in part, a second user to follow up with the first user to schedule and/or complete, based, at least in part, on the final summary, a service or transaction mentioned during the chatbot interaction.
